Ferrari's Dynamic Duo Delivers Podium Performance at China Sprint, Chasing Russell's Victory
Charles Leclerc and Lewis Hamilton showcased Ferrari's competitive form by securing both podium positions at the China Sprint, though George Russell ultimately crossed the line first. The Scuderia pair's strong showing demonstrates the team's progress in 2026.

Ferrari experienced a successful outing at the China Sprint, with Charles Leclerc and Lewis Hamilton both reaching the podium in what proved to be a competitive race. The pair pushed hard against race victor George Russell throughout the encounter, ultimately finishing behind the winner but ahead of the remaining field.
The performance underscores Ferrari's strength during this stage of the 2026 season, with both drivers capitalizing on the team's recent development work. While Russell's victory went to the top step, Leclerc and Hamilton's dual podium finish represents a solid day's work for the Italian outfit and demonstrates their continued challenge for race wins.
The result marks an encouraging moment for Ferrari as the team seeks to build momentum through the season.
